Jasper Johnson Set to Take Over College Basketball: Kentucky’s Rising Star Backed by Coach Mark Pope as Nation’s Most Dangerous Scorer Heading into the 2025 Season
Lexington, KY – May 24, 2025
In a bold and confident statement that has reverberated throughout the college basketball world, new Kentucky head coach Mark Pope declared freshman phenom Jasper Johnson as “the most dangerous scorer in all of college basketball next year.” The remark has stirred buzz and expectations, painting Johnson as the centerpiece of a new era for the Wildcats.
Jasper Johnson, a 6-foot-5 five-star shooting guard out of Link Academy in Missouri, was one of the most coveted recruits in the 2025 class. Known for his deep shooting range, explosiveness off the dribble, and court vision well beyond his years, Johnson brings a combination of athleticism and scoring finesse rarely seen at the college level.

The Making of a Star
Jasper Johnson’s basketball pedigree runs deep. The son of former college standout Dennis Johnson, he’s been groomed for this level of competition since childhood. During his final high school season, Johnson averaged 28.4 points, 6.1 rebounds, and 4.2 assists per game while shooting over 42% from beyond the arc. His performances in the McDonald’s All-American Game and the Nike Hoop Summit only elevated his stock.
Off the court, Johnson is already gaining traction as a name, image, and likeness (NIL) standout. Multiple endorsements and partnerships are lining up, with brands eager to associate with what could be one of the breakout stars of the 2025-26 NCAA season.
